Perfect Square
726786647152531225756293005545776289135319056 is a perfect square (26958980825552942734084 × 26958980825552942734084)
726786647152531225756293005545776289135319056 is a perfect square (26958980825552942734084 × 26958980825552942734084)
726786647152531225756293005545776289135319056 is even
Previous even number is 726786647152531225756293005545776289135319054
Next even number is 726786647152531225756293005545776289135319058
383902392766822064779786221779131375917212797801930313423335469218815044990436222759058303513464230392923420882850062897457879929327616
528218830479217925283698240131051531147159344123882881588717558774325945447637614916731136
100000100101110001100111111110101101010010111110011110001010000100000010001101010001111111111001000111000011100010100011011110110100011101100000010000